    Sir John Robert Hills, CBE (29 July 1954 – 21 December 2020) was a British academic, latterly professor of Social Policy at the London School of Economics. He acted as director of the ESRC Research Centre for the Analysis of Social Exclusion from 1997. His work focused on inequality, and the role of social policy over the life course. (Source: DBPedia)
